## Ownership

The tile prefetcher (`tilescout/`) is the bit that guesses which map tiles a user will pan to next and warms the cache ahead of time. It's twitchy — small changes to the scoring window can tank hit rates on the Veldmark region servers, so please run the replay benchmark before approving anything. Reviews need at least one sign-off from the maintainer. If you're unsure whether a change is safe, ping the person named below.

account owner for bawip-fajeg: Ralix Oliwyn

OFF-SITE RUN CHECKLIST — Item 7: Uniforms, Greystoke Depot Opening

Coordinator to confirm the full uniform consignment for the new Greystoke depot is loaded on the Tuesday run: forty hi-vis jackets, forty polo shirts in mixed sizes, and the embroidered supervisor fleeces. Sizes are listed on the packing note taped to carton one. Shortages must be flagged to stores before departure, not after. The confidential instruction covering the courier hand-over is printed directly below.

courier memo of tawep-tajep: the quenius ulaiel courier leaves the fenir ledger at gate 9128 under passcode 527513

**Alert: TraceGapHigh — Lattuce Request Tracing**

This alert fires when more than 5% of requests crossing the Lattuce order-routing microservices arrive without a parent trace span. Missing spans usually mean a service is stripping trace headers, which makes debugging latency issues nearly impossible downstream. Before escalating, check which service first drops the header using the trace waterfall view. Full triage steps for new responders are documented on the internal page below.

operations page: https://confluence.tolvaqsys.corp/spaces/pages/pages/6e787158f507